Start with site preparation: ensure a level, stable foundation or transport chassis. For stationary units, pour a concrete pad; for mobile units, secure the trailer. Connect the plant to a three-phase power supply per local codes. Calibrate the weighing sensors using the included manual; this step is critical for accurate batching. The manufacturer provides a commissioning engineer for turnkey orders, which simplifies the process immensely.
Power on the control panel and familiarize yourself with the touchscreen interface. The system initially runs in manual mode for testing. Set your aggregate bins and cement silo levels. Perform a dry run with no material to verify motor rotation, conveyor direction, and sensor feedback. The learning curve is moderate—most operators become comfortable within two shifts.
In automatic mode, input your mix design recipe (e.g., proportions of sand, gravel, cement, water). The plant automatically feeds aggregates, weighs them, and transfers them to the mixer. Monitor the batch consistency on the display. For best results, always pre-wet the mixer drum before the first batch and maintain proper moisture content in aggregates.
Use the recipe library to store common mix designs for quick recall. Experiment with the moisture compensation feature—this adjusts water addition based on real-time aggregate moisture readings, improving consistency. The manual allows for fine-tuning the mix cycle time, which can increase throughput by up to 15 percent.
Daily: inspect the mixer blades for wear and check belt tension. Weekly: lubricate all bearings and clean the weighing hoppers. Monthly: calibrate the pressure sensors and inspect electrical connections. The industrial equipment maintenance guide on our site provides additional insights for long-term care.
If batches are inconsistent, check the sensors for material buildup. If the mixer stalls, reduce the batch size or check aggregate moisture. For control errors, reset the system and ensure all safety interlocks are engaged. When in doubt, contact YG support via the provided WhatsApp number (+86 138 3716 1201).

Use the recipe library to create baseline mixes for your most common projects. This reduces setup time for repeat batches and ensures consistency.
Spend 10 minutes each morning verifying sensor readings against a known weight. This simple step prevents costly inaccuracies over the day.
A concrete mixing system performs best with a good quality water meter and aggregate moisture sensor—both relatively inexpensive upgrades.
In cold weather, preheat your water and use the system’s heating circuit for the mixer. In hot weather, add ice to the batch to maintain workability.
Create a calendar for monthly bearing greasing, quarterly sensor calibration, and annual mixer blade replacement. Preventive care extends equipment life significantly.
The manual includes hidden settings for cycle time reduction and moisture compensation. Experiment with these to find your optimal balance of speed and quality.
Ensure at least two people on your crew can operate the system confidently. This avoids downtime if the primary operator is unavailable and helps share knowledge.
